Transaction

d2cb6ef855d68eb920ea298710061f500db44600ffc4e7d59798cb9edb1414cf
499,662 confirmations
Timestamp
1480492121
Block441,246
Fee40,000 sats
Fee rate120.5 sats/vB
view on mempool.space

Inputs & Outputs